Title
ALS calibration: Analytic expressions for the antenna gains of a two and three element east-west interferometer

Abstract
Studying a simple problem first, for which an analytic solution exists, can greatly improve our understanding of a complex problem. An undesired result of calibrating with an incomplete sky model is calibration systematics. Studying the systematics contained in the antenna gains of a simple east-west interferometer could aid us in understanding the artefacts associated with calibration in general. This paper aims to derive analytic expressions of the antenna gain vectors that were obtained during the calibration (using an incomplete sky model) of a two and three element east-west interferometer.
